Output d45c9410aa1ea62a7d844708948e22680cf690bf6daea053e152645dc2e25b3d:13

value
39405115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50245ace8057cea073f2958bcb2700865f2ad82f OP_EQUAL
address
38zmXrqAXjVBNaHjymKSzY34vpS9TDju52
transaction
d45c9410aa1ea62a7d844708948e22680cf690bf6daea053e152645dc2e25b3d
spent
true